Nausea, headache, insomnia, fatigue, dizziness, and dry mouth are common, often decreasing over time. though cipralex which is escitalopram, it is usually a secondary or supplemental option rather than the first-line treatment, It is most effective when used alongside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) or Exposure Therapy, which are the "gold standard" treatments for specific phobias.
Claustrophobia is anxiety disorder causing distress in closed spaces. Although it is irrational but seems very true. As a result, a person experiences panic like symptoms, such as rapid heart rate, rapid but shallow breathing, sweating, dizziness, restlessness, nausea, difficulty in breathing and fear not being able to get out of confined space and probably fear of dying. It may be a learned behaviour or a response to past traumatic stress. The best and most effective way to treat phobias is by combining Exposure Therapy through imagery and Relaxation Techniques via Deep Breathing. It is done under strict supervision of an expert psychotherapist. Depending upon the severity, adjunct treatment may be necessary with a low dose of benzodiazepines and SSRIs. Medicines are chemicals and do have side-effects, but side effects are very minor as compared to the distress that the individual is going through and are easily managable. To be suffering from any fear or phobia is in itself is an extremely agonizing condition. So, entering therapy at the earliest is vitally important.
